Abstract

An electroluminescent device, including a space-apart anode and cathode; and an emissive layer disposed between the space-apart anode and cathode and including an organic compound having a complex fluorene structure represented by one of the following formulas: wherein: X 1 , X 2 , X 3 , and X 4 are individually the same or different and include a moiety containing CH or N; R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, and R 4 are substituents each being individually hydrogen, or alkyl, or alkenyl, or alkynyl, or alkoxy of from 1 to 40 carbon atoms; aryl or substituted aryl of from 6 to 60 carbon atoms; or heteroaryl or substituted heteroaryl of from 4 to 60 carbons; or F, Cl, or Br; or a cyano group; or a nitro group; or R 3 , or R 4 or both are groups that form fused aromatic or heteroaromatic rings.

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. An electroluminescent device, comprising 
 a) a space-apart anode and cathode; and    b) an emissive layer disposed between the space-apart anode and cathode and including an organic compound having a complex fluorene structure represented by one of the following formulas:                          wherein:    X 1 , X 2 , X 3 , and X 4  are individually the same or different and include a moiety containing CH or N; R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, and R 4  are substituents each being individually hydrogen, or alkyl, or alkenyl, or alkynyl, or alkoxy of from 1 to 40 carbon atoms; aryl or substituted aryl of from 6 to 60 carbon atoms; or heteroaryl or substituted heteroaryl of from 4 to 60 carbons; or F, Cl, or Br; or a cyano group; or a nitro group; or R 3 , or R 4  or both are groups that form fused aromatic or heteroaromatic rings.    
     
     
         2 . The electroluminescent device of  claim 1  wherein the organic compound having the complex fluorene structure is a small molecule or a polymer or mixture thereof.  
     
     
         3 . The electroluminescent device of  claim 1  wherein the organic compound having the complex fluorene structure is a small molecule represented by formula:  
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ein Y 1  and Y 2  each individually represent a substituted or unsubstituted alkyl, alkenyl, alkynyl, aryl, or heteroaryl or other conjugated groups, and y 1  and y 2  are integers from 0 to 6, and wherein Y 1  and Y 2  are the same or different.  
     
     
         4 . The organic compound in  claim 1  wherein the organic compound having the complex fluorene structure is a polymer represented by repeating units of formula (V) or formula (VI)  
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ein:  
       X 5  and X 6  are linking groups, Y 1  and Y 2  are each individually represented as a substituted or unsubstituted alkyl, alkenyl, alkynyl, aryl, or heteroaryl or other conjugated groups, and y 1  and Y 2  are integers from 0 to 6, and x is an integer from 0 to 6.  
     
     
         5 . A method of making an electroluminescent device, comprising the steps of: 
 a) providing a space-apart anode and cathode; and    b) depositing an emissive layer between the space-apart anode and cathode and including an organic compound having a complex small molecule or fluorene structure represented by one of the following formulas                          wherein:    X 1 , X 2 , X 3 , and X 4  are individually the same or different and include a moiety containing CH or N; R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, and R 4  are substituents each being individually hydrogen, or alkyl, or alkenyl, or alkynyl, or alkoxy of from 1 to 40 carbon atoms; aryl or substituted aryl of from 6 to 60 carbon atoms; or heteroaryl or substituted heteroaryl of from 4 to 60 carbons; or F, Cl, or Br; or a cyano group; or a nitro group; or R 3 , or R 4  or both are groups that form fused aromatic or heteroaromatic rings; or R 3 , or R 4  or both represent one or more than one substituents.    
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5  wherein the organic compound having the complex fluorene structure is a polymer produced according to the following reaction: contacting (a) aromatic monomers having at least two reactive trifluorosulfonate groups and aromatic monomers having at least two reactive boron derivative groups selected from boronic acid, boronic ester, or borane groups or (b) aromatic monomers having one reactive trifluorosulfonaate group and one boron derivative group selected from boronic acid, boronic ester, or borane groups, with each other; in a reaction mixture which comprises: (i) a catalytic amount of a catalyst, (ii) an organic or inorganic base, and (iii) an organic solvent, under reaction conditions sufficient to form conjugated polymer.  
     
     
         7 . An electroluminescent device which comprises an anode, a cathode, and an organic compound disposed between the space-apart anode and cathode, the organic compound being doped with one or more fluorescent dyes, phosphorescent dopants, or other light emitting materials, the organic compound including complex fluorene structure is represented by one of the following formulas  
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ein:  
       X 1 , X 2 , X 3 , and X 4  are individually the same or different and include a moiety containing CH or N; R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, and R 4  are substituents each being individually hydrogen, or alkyl, or alkenyl, or alkynyl, or alkoxy of from 1 to 40 carbon atoms; aryl or substituted aryl of from 6 to 60 carbon atoms; or heteroaryl or substituted heteroaryl of from 4 to 60 carbons; or F, Cl, or Br; or a cyano group; or a nitro group; or R 3 , or R 4  or both are groups that form fused aromatic or heteroaromatic rings; or R 3 , or R 4  or both represent one or more than one substituents.
